Wine Details
Lot 251 boasts sweet red fruit overlayed with graphite, espresso, and blackberry. Fresh, dense, rich and elegant, It's a superb take on Rhone blending done California style. This wine plays great acidity off of sweet fruit for a rich yet playful blend.

- Vintage
- 2009
- Appellation
- California
- Grape
- Carignane 2%, Mourvedre 4%, Grenache 43%, Syrah 51%
- Alcohol by Volume
- 14.3%
- Cases Produced
- 6200
- Drink/hold
- Now and through 2015

CHW Confidential
CHW Confidential
Sourced from an excellent winery in Arroyo Seco, this bottle comes from a $30 dollar bottle program that we hope to have the opportunity to source from again. We're currently looking at their 2010 vintage and have been really impressed with the complexity of their wines and winegrowing skills. These guys have been making wine since the early seventies and are pioneers of great California wines.
